Public proxy

Public Proxy is an Internet protocol that allows users to access websites and online services without revealing their identities or location. It is a type of proxy server that acts as a middle-man between the user and the target server. The proxy server may be a computer in another country or in another part of your own host country.

Public proxies can provide various levels of anonymity, depending on the user’s needs and security requirements. For example, a public proxy may be used to access a website that is blocked in their region. It can also be used to access geoblocked sites or simply to browse anonymously. Many public proxies also encrypt the data being sent between the user and the target server, thus providing additional security.

Public proxies are a popular way to access the Internet and there are many free and paid providers available online. Most offer a wide range of services such as IP masking, data encryption, speed throttling, and anonymity. Some providers offer servers based on geographical locations, while others may have different levels of protection. While public proxies can provide a level of security and anonymity, users should research the provider before using their services, as they may contain malware, viruses, or other malicious software.
